Hiking around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y offers access to diverse landscapes within the Savoie department of the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es region. The commune is situated on the slopes of the Bauges Massif, characterized by cliffs, forests, and alpine pastures. The area features a network of trails through vineyards, around lakes, and into the surrounding valleys, providing varied terrain for outdoor activities. This region of the French Alps presents opportunities for exploring natural features and scenic vistas.

It is a surprise to arrive at this vertical rock face, the quarry, with the clear view on the left, dominating Detrier below and the Moutaret further to the left. It is a beautiful little valley that can only be seen from above. From there, a hiking trail leads to the chapel of Ste Marguerite before going back down to Arvillard on the other side of Mont Pézard.

The Col de Cochette from La Trinité is 2.99 km long with a total drop of 237 m. The average gradient is 7.9% with maximum gradients of 10%. From Villard-d'Héry, it is 1.89 km with an average gradient of 7.8%. There is a total drop of 148m.

The Lac de Sainte Hélène, a natural lake fed by the Coisetan stream, is a preserved area where the banks remain wild. A landscaped path accessible to people with reduced mobility allows you to go around the lake away from the banks. Ideal picnic point and departure point for hikes. No swimming.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y?

There are over 200 hiking routes around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y, offering a wide range of options for all skill levels. This includes 67 easy routes, 115 moderate trails, and 36 more challenging hikes.

What types of landscapes can I expect to see while hiking in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y?

Hiking around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y offers diverse landscapes, from the cliffs, forests, and alpine pastures of the Bauges Massif to picturesque vineyards and serene lakes. The region is part of the French Alps, providing stunning mountain vistas and varied terrain.

Are there any easy, family-friendly hikes in the area?

Yes,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y has many easy routes suitable for families. An excellent option is the Lac de Sainte Hélène loop from Sainte-Hélène-du-Lac, an easy 4.1 km trail that takes just over an hour to complete, offering pleasant lake views.

Can I find circular hiking routes around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y?

Many of the trails in the region are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. For example, the Lac Saint Clair – La carrière loop from Détrier is a moderate 8.4 km path that winds around Lac Saint Clair, offering varied scenery.

What are some notable natural attractions or viewpoints along the trails?

The region offers several natural attractions and viewpoints. You can find stunning vistas like the Watch Rock or enjoy the tranquility of Lake Saint-André. The Lac de Sainte Hélène is also a beautiful spot for hikers.

Are there any hikes that go through vineyards?

Yes, the area surrounding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y is known for its Savoie vineyards. You can find trails that lead through these undulating wine countries, offering a unique hiking experience that combines natural beauty with viticultural discovery.

What is the best time of year to go hiking in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y?

The region is part of the French Alps, so spring, summer, and early autumn generally offer the most favorable conditions for hiking, with pleasant temperatures and accessible trails. Winter hiking might be possible on lower elevation trails, but higher routes could be affected by snow.

What do other hikers say about the trails in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y?

The routes in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 stars from over 500 reviews. Hikers often praise the diverse terrain, from serene lakes to scenic mountain paths, and the well-maintained trails.

Are there any longer, more challenging hikes available?

Yes, for those seeking a longer challenge, the Tower – Scenic Pathway loop from Saint-Pierre-de-Soucy is a moderate 10 km route that takes approximately 3 hours and 25 minutes, offering more elevation gain and expansive views.

Can I find routes that offer views of mountain peaks?

Absolutely. Being on the slopes of the Bauges Massif and part of the French Alps, many trails provide access to mountainous terrain and impressive viewpoints. You can find routes leading to summits like La Galoppaz Peak or offering views towards the Belledonne Range.

Are there any moderate trails that are a good length for a half-day hike?

For a moderate half-day hike, consider the La Bathie track loop from Villaroux. This 7.3 km trail takes about 2 hours and 11 minutes, leading through local tracks and countryside, perfect for an extended outing.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the moderate trails?

Moderate trails in Saint-Pierre-De-Soucy often feature a mix of terrain, including forest paths, open countryside, and some ascents and descents. For instance, the Col de Cochette (587 m) – Tower loop from Villard-d'Héry is a moderate 7.3 km route with varied elevation, offering a good workout and scenic views.
